WebThe Secret Fire is a power of Ilúvatar. What Anor refers to is a mystery. It's never explained, but in early drafts the life said he was a wielder of the White Flame. White representing good seems to confirm that this line is Gandalf saying he is a servant of Ilúvatar and wields his power. Afalstein • 7 yr. ago. WebSep 28, 2024 · Etymology. The literal meaning of ‘Flame of Anor’ is ‘The Light of the Sun’ because Anor stands for the Sun in Elvish. This light is believed to have come from the fruit of the Two Trees of Valinor. … WebJan 24, 2024 · Anor (derived from the root ANÁR), the common name in Sindarin, as seen in Minas Anor, the Gondorian province of Anórien, and elanor ("Sun-star"). Vása ("the Consumer"), or Heart of Fire, a name given by the Noldor as it marked the waning of the Elves. Aþâraigas ("appointed heat"), its in Valarin. Kalantar ("Light-giver").
